About The Position

Texas Global is seeking a creative and detail-oriented undergraduate student with a background in videography, multimedia production, and photography to assist with the Marketing and Communications team’s visual storytelling. This position offers hands-on experience in editing video and photo, packaging visual journalistic stories, and collaborating with our team to enhance and promote our global portfolio through dynamic videos and photo essays. Marketing and Communications is the creative and marketing team for Texas Global, showcasing the depth and breadth of the University’s global engagement activities across campus and abroad, supporting the mission of the University and enhancing its reputation around the world through strategic messaging, branding, and storytelling.
